Ladestiny's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Divide Ladestiny's SSA record in two at 2001 and the more recent half accounts for 53% of all births, the earlier half the remaining 47%, a genuinely balanced usage pattern. Its calmest year was 2002, with only 5 births recorded -- set against the 1998 peak of 9, that's the full swing in one name's fortunes.
